avoid mark_t::count() when possible
count() may be implemented using a loop, so using it touch check count() == 1 or count() > 1 is not advisable. * spot/twa/acc.hh (mark_t::is_singleton, mark_t::has_many): Introduce these two methods to replace count()==1 and count()>1 * spot/twa/acc.cc, spot/twaalgos/cleanacc.cc, spot/twaalgos/determinize.cc, spot/twaalgos/dtwasat.cc, spot/twaalgos/iscolored.cc, spot/twaalgos/remfin.cc, spot/twaalgos/toparity.cc: Adjust usage.
